Emergency and trauma care

Essential trauma care project

WHO guidance documents such as Prehospital trauma care systems, Guidelines for essential trauma care, and Guidelines for trauma quality improvement programmes set reasonable, affordable and sustainable standards for the care of injured persons worldwide. They define a set of trauma care services considered essential to prevent death and disability in injured patients and that could be provided to almost all injured persons in any given setting. The basic principles and methods proposed in the guidance documents have been implemented in several countries, including Ghana, India, Mexico and Viet Nam. These efforts have provided valuable lessons that are relevant for future actions to promote the recommendations contained in the guidance documents.
